What is integrative wellness?

Integrative wellness is an approach to health that considers the whole person—body, mind, and spirit—by combining conventional medicine with complementary therapies and lifestyle changes. It focuses on prevention, nutrition, stress management, physical activity, and other factors that influence well-being. Practitioners work collaboratively with clients to develop personalized wellness plans that address physical, emotional, and social aspects of health. The goal is to optimize overall health and prevent illness, rather than just treating symptoms.

How does an Integrative Wellness professional typically collaborate with other healthcare providers to support client outcomes?

Integrative Wellness professionals often work as part of interdisciplinary teams that may include physicians, nutritionists, mental health counselors, and fitness experts. They coordinate care by sharing insights and progress updates, ensuring that a client's wellness plan addresses all aspects of health—physical, emotional, and lifestyle. Regular team meetings and open communication are common, enabling a holistic approach to client care and helping to resolve any overlapping or conflicting recommendations. This collaborative structure not only enhances client outcomes but also fosters ongoing professional growth through shared expertise.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an Integrative Wellness practitioner,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Integrative Wellness Practitioner, a strong background in health sciences, nutrition, holistic care, and relevant certifications such as health coaching or integrative medicine is essential. Familiarity with wellness assessment tools, client management software, and evidence-based integrative modalities is typically required. Exceptional communication, empathy, and motivational skills help practitioners build trust and guide clients through lifestyle changes. These skills are vital for delivering comprehensive, client-centered care that promotes long-term wellness and positive health outcomes.

What is the difference between Integrative Wellness vs Holistic Health Coach?

AspectIntegrative WellnessHolistic Health Coach
CredentialsCertifications in wellness, nutrition, or holistic practices; often licensed or certified by recognized bodiesCertification from holistic health coaching programs; focus on lifestyle and behavior change
Work EnvironmentClinics, wellness centers, private practices, corporate wellness programsPrivate coaching, online platforms, health retreats
Industry UsageHealthcare, wellness, integrative medicine settingsHealth and wellness coaching, lifestyle improvement

Integrative Wellness professionals focus on a comprehensive approach combining medical, nutritional, and holistic practices to improve overall health. Holistic Health Coaches primarily guide clients on lifestyle and behavioral changes to promote wellness. While both roles emphasize holistic health, Integrative Wellness practitioners often work alongside healthcare providers, whereas Holistic Health Coaches typically operate independently or in coaching settings.

What can I do with an integrative wellness degree?

An integrative wellness degree prepares individuals for careers in holistic health, including roles such as wellness coach, health educator, or integrative health practitioner. Graduates often work in healthcare settings, wellness centers, or private practice, utilizing skills in nutrition, stress management, and lifestyle counseling.
